Back to Basics: Wrap Blouses

Jul 9, 2021

A wrap top may not seem like a basic, but once you own one, you will understand why it reaches staple status.  If your weight fluctuates (and whose doesn’t these days), a wrap blouse creates a flattering, comfortable look.  I wear mine with wide leg pants or pencil skirts or jeans on casual days.

& Other Stories is my go-to source for anything with a wrap — blouses, dresses, sweaters.  Their selection is always best.  Their price points are a Zara level, and the quality is about the same, sometimes better.

This black-dotted blouse is a really nice option for black separates.  They also have this nice all-black option.  And if you’re feeling loungewear, try this TENCEL top in khaki or black.

Another brand that often has wrap-style tops is Vince Camuto.  This bold hibiscus color is nice.  It’s also available in plus size, as is this basic black one.

Wrap tops are a great throw on piece because they look polished with or without a jacket.  Just add a good earring and a good shoe and be on your merry way.
